After the beast crisis ended, due to the severe damage to the Border District, it was no longer suitable for habitation, and the Border refugees were temporarily resettled by the authorities in the city.

The resettlement area was located in the Rust Wall District, guarded by government troops 24 hours a day. An unfinished building was allocated to the Wolf Assault group, where all their members stayed.

It was breakfast time now, and the members of the Wolf Assault group were transporting the living supplies given by the authorities, soaking bowls of instant noodles to distribute to their companions.

When Su Mo and Troy arrived, all the Wolf Assault members, whether they were boiling water, eating, or resting, stood up one after another and cast respectful glances.

Su Mo nodded in greeting to them and followed Troy upstairs.

In a room on the 6th floor, Su Mo saw Hibell.

Due to the building being unfinished, the furnishings were very crude, with all the interiors being raw, and there were no doors or windows, only some iron supports picked up from outside supporting pieces of ragged cloth to block the wind.

Hibell lay on a mattress behind the wind-blocking curtain, covered with a thick, tattered quilt. Her face was pale as paper. Despite being wrapped tightly, she couldn’t stop trembling, and cold sweat kept streaming down her forehead, soaking the pillow.

Her consciousness was already blurred, unaware even of Su Mo’s arrival. Her eyes were half-open, half-closed, and unfocused. Several Wolf Assault doctors responsible for her care were at a loss, helpless.

Troy said in a trembling voice, "After returning from that last beast blockade, her condition has deteriorated rapidly. At first, she couldn’t eat or drink, then she began vomiting blood throughout the night, and now she falls unconscious at any moment, only having a few hours of wakefulness each day..."

Su Mo gazed at the haggard Hibell without speaking, feeling like a stone was pressing on his heart.

Su Mo naturally understood Hibell’s condition; like the former Nuobai, she was a patient with "Blood Code Dissociation Syndrome."

The Blood Code is recognized as the most potent power among the three major Extraordinary Systems. Unlike the smoothly increasing trajectory of the implants and the Spiritual Brain, the power curve of the Blood Code is exponential.

The early performance of the Blood Code is terrible, to the extent that low-level Blood Code Carriers getting killed by ordinary people single-handedly is not uncommon.

However, the higher the Blood Code level, the more dramatic the increase, far surpassing the power of implants and the Spiritual Brain.

This is why those with a high regard for themselves are more inclined towards the Blood Code, as becoming a Blood Code Carrier implies greater possibilities.

But this pursuit comes with a price.

Using implants or the Spiritual Brain also comes with a price, but at least the risks are controllable.

For example, with implants, even if the body can’t bear it and an immune rejection response occurs, there are medications, lower-grade implants can be exchanged, and there’s always a fallback.

But the Blood Code is different. Once you become a Blood Code Carrier, an eternal shadow follows – the Blood Code Dissociation Syndrome.

The probability of this disease occurring is not high; perhaps only one or two out of tens of thousands of Blood Code Carriers will get it.

However, if you are unfortunate enough to contract this disease, it becomes a true nightmare.

The pain it causes is indescribable in ordinary language and cannot be alleviated by any painkillers.

There is a cure, but it’s firmly in the hands of the Hegemony Company—that’s the "Genetic Compilation Protein" Su Mo and Nuobai once went to look for together.

Unlike the easily available immune suppressants for implants, Genetic Compilation Protein is a top-level restricted item of the Hegemony Company, with extremely stringent approvals for each entry and exit, requiring the permission of the highest regional responsible person like Zhao Yiming.

This is the company’s cold strategy. The Blood Code can be leaked, even released recklessly, obtainable on the black market by anyone with money, making anyone a Blood Code Carrier.

As for what to do if unfortunate enough to contract Blood Code Dissociation Syndrome after acquiring the Blood Code?

You can turn to the company, forever serving as the company’s dog, and the company will help treat you—of course, provided that the company finds you worthwhile.

If the company doesn’t deem you worthwhile, or if you don’t want to come, fine, you can watch helplessly as your body collapses with each episode.

Nuobai was forced to work for Elder Tang because she had previously offended the Hegemony Company and couldn’t turn to them, while Elder Tang happened to promise her Genetic Compilation Protein, leading her down that hopeless path.

Elder Tang actually had no such medicine; with his social status, let alone obtaining Genetic Compilation Protein, even seeing it with his own eyes would mean the company’s logistics department had failed, and a bunch of people would face severe consequences.

Elder Tang was completely deceiving Nuobai, planning to use her until she was drained and then cast her aside.

Nuobai was undoubtedly fortunate to have met Su Mo and found a last hope in the Land of No Master ruins.

But Hibell is unfortunate. Even though she met Su Mo, Su Mo has no way to save her, as he genuinely doesn’t know where to find that thing, not to mention that even with Nuobai, it was a desperate gamble.

Su Mo lowered his eyes and said in a soft voice, "I’m sorry, Troy, seeing Hibell like this makes me sad too, but with my current ability, I can’t help her..."

Troy’s eyes widened, and his voice was noticeably trembling. "How is that possible? Don’t you know Zhao Yiming? He’s the head of the New Moon City region for the Hegemony Company. It’s certainly not difficult for him to get a Genetic Compilation Protein!"

"Indeed, it’s not difficult for him," Su Mo said, looking into Troy’s eyes, his gaze and voice both wistful, "The question is, what can we offer him in exchange?"

Troy said anxiously, "Can you at least ask him? Just ask first, and then..."
